WebSGLT-2 inhibitors are currently approved for people with type 2 diabetes. They also improve kidney and heart failure outcomes in patients with chronic kidney disease and heart disease, regardless of diabetes status. WebNov 17, 2024 · The FDA has approved Provention Bio’s Tzield (teplizumab), a new therapy that could delay the onset of type 1 diabetes by an average of 2 years. Find out about screening and how to know whether treatment with Tzield may be right for you. Finding a cure for type 1 diabetes (T1D) has been a priority in diabetes research for decades.
